SCHULENBURG —The Turtle Wing Foundation’s 12th annual Toast was a success.

Community members, donors, volunteers, board, families, and those who wanted to learn more about the Turtle Wing Foundation gathered at Sengelmann Hall on Thursday, Jan. 26 to “remember, rejoice, and renew” with Turtle Wing Foundation.

This year’s theme was “The Art of Turtle Wing”, and showcased how Turtle Wing individuals have learned to express themselves and “grow wings” through the arts.

The foundation said special performances by the Dancing Turtles and Ninja Turtles, inclusive dance and taekwondo classes through On Pointe Dance Studio, were a huge hit. Art created by Turtle Wing kids through the foundation partnership with Arts for Rural Texas were also on display throughout the venue.

According to a release, the organization was happy to be able to “remember” where the foundation came from, “rejoice” in the foundation’s accomplishments, and “renew” their mission and drive to continue changing lives with the members of communities they serve.

Turtle Wing Foundation is a 501(c)3 nonprofit organization with the mission of helping individuals with learning challenges in rural areas achieve their full potential.
